Scott Brady is a Vice Chairman and Co-Manager of CBRE Nashville’s Debt & Structured Finance (DSF) division. Mr. Brady’s primary focus is sourcing debt and equity for CBRE’s multifamily and commercial clientele on a national level. Through an extensive network of over 200 capital sources, including Freddie Mac, Fannie Mae, HUD, he works extensively on permanent financing, construction financing, tax increment financing (TIF), bridge and mezzanine debt as wells as joint venture/preferred equity assignments.
Over the course his 23-year real estate career, Mr. Brady has been responsible for the origination of over $13 billion. Together with business partner K.O. Kennedy, Mr. Brady’s debt & structured finance production consistently exceeds $1.8 Billion annually, translating to over $2.5 Billion worth of real estate transactions every year. He has been named a “Top 100 Producer” within CBRE nationwide and a member of the “Colbert Caldwell Circle”.

Prior Experience
Prior to joining CBRE in 2007, Mr. Brady spent 10 years in the commercial real estate banking industry. Mr. Brady was a Senior Vice President overseeing Fifth Third Bank’s Middle Tennessee Commercial and Residential Real Estate Department and held other senior loan production positions with SunTrust Bank, National Bank of Commerce, and SouthTrust Bank.
